Berhampur: A Class X girl student delivered a baby in a residential school hostel in Kandhamal district following which its headmistress was suspended and two contractual teachers disengaged for alleged negligence, officials said on Wednesday.

The Class X student of the school had delivered a baby in the hostel on Friday night, they said.

Following the incident, the Kandhamal district administration suspended headmistress of Lingagada Residential Girls High School Ashalata Pati and disengaged contractual teachers, Sasmita Parida and Namita Pradhan yesterday, they said.

An auxiliary nurse midwife (ANM) S B Pradhan, responsible for the health care of the students, was also removed.

Kandhamal district Collector, N Thirumala Naik who visited the school on Saturday said, "How could the ANM and teachers not know about the health condition of the girl?. This is nothing but negligence on the part of the school authorities."

Police said they had registered a case in connection with the incident based on a complaint lodged by Khajuripada block extension officer.
